Over the last 4 years, the loop heat pipe (LHP) technology has been under development by this institute, focusing on future applications for this passive thermal control device, specially related to instruments' thermal control in satellites. Such a development has been focused on designing, manufacturing, assembling, charging and testing LHPs for Space applications using acetone as working fluid. Several procedures were specially conceived during the development program, which resulted in reliable apparatuses that have been extensively tested for potential applications. Repeatability on the processes used during the manufacturing of the LHPs was established as the key parameter to qualify this technology, as well as suppliers and techniques for charging and testing procedures. As a result, several LHPs were manufactured and are operational presenting reliable results related to the thermal control, according to the parameters established by the project. In parallel, two mathematical models were developed based on the experimental data gathered in laboratory conditions, which were then validated and have been applied on the design of LHPs for Earth orbit operation.
